CUET Cutoff 2025-26 (Official)

Normalized CUET (UG) 2025 Score Requirements

Category Cutoff Marks Status
General (UR) 353 Most Competitive
OBC-NCL 350 High Demand
SC 240 Moderate
ST ALL Open
EWS 340 Competitive
PwD No seat available
Note: “ALL” for ST category indicates seats available for all eligible candidates meeting academic criteria. Cutoffs may vary each year based on various factors.

CSE vs Other Branches Cutoff Comparison

CUET 2025-26 Cutoff (General Category)

Branch Cutoff Marks Competition Level
Computer Science (CSE) 353 Most Competitive
Information Technology (IT) 287 High
Electronics & Communication (ECE) 278 Moderate-High
Mechanical Engineering (ME) 211 Moderate
Instrumentation Engineering (IE) ALL Open for All

Analysis: CSE has the highest cutoff, making it the most sought-after branch with 75+ marks difference from IT branch.

CUET Subject Combination & Eligibility

Required CUET (UG) Domain Subjects for CSE

Compulsory Subjects

  • Physics (Mandatory)
  • Mathematics (Mandatory)

Third Subject (Choose One)

  • Computer Science (Preferred)
  • Informatics Practices (Alternative)

Exam Pattern

  • Computer-Based Test (CBT)
  • Conducted by NTA
  • Merit list based on normalized CUET score

Class 12 Eligibility for CSE Admission

Academic Requirements

  • Passed 10+2 / Intermediate from recognized Board
  • Physics and Mathematics compulsory in Class 12

Third Subject Options

  • Chemistry
  • Computer Science
  • Electronics
  • Information Technology
  • Informatics Practices

Minimum Percentage

  • General: 45% aggregate in 3 subjects
  • Reserved: 40% aggregate (SC/ST/OBC/EWS/PwD)

Counselling & Admission Timeline

1

CUET Result

Expected: Late June 2025 by NTA. Download your score card immediately.

2

HNBGU Merit List

Published: Early August 2025. Category-wise merit list released on official website.

3

Offline Counselling

Mid-August 2025 at Department of CSE, Chauras Campus. Physical reporting mandatory.

4

Seat Allotment

Strictly as per CUET score, category and branch choice. Document verification conducted.

5

Fee Deposit

Required immediately after allotment. Non-compliance leads to cancellation of candidature.

Documents Required

Essential Documents for Counselling

Aadhaar Card (Self-attested photocopy)
Class 10 Certificate and Marksheet
Class 12 Certificate and Marksheet
CUET (UG) 2025 Score Card
HNBGU Merit List Printout
Category Certificates (if applicable)
Transfer/Migration Certificate
Character Certificate
Anti-Ragging Affidavit
Gap Year Affidavit (if applicable)
Five Passport-size Photographs

Important: All documents must be original along with self-attested photocopies. Incomplete documentation may lead to rejection.
